**Ticket: Expired credential for Proseguard doc linter**

External plugin authors have reported that the Proseguard documentation linter rejects all submissions with an authentication error. Root cause: the shared service credential expired on schedule and the renewal job silently failed. A fresh credential has been issued with identical scopes, so no plugin-side configuration changes are needed beyond replacement. Update your plugin settings with the new key below.

API key for tagug-tajef: vxb4-R1fo

/*
 * Health-check constants for the Quayline balancer tier.
 * Reviewer note: probe responses deliberately omit version
 * strings and uptime to avoid fingerprinting, and the probe
 * endpoint is bound only to the internal interface. Failure
 * thresholds were chosen so a single slow disk on a Fenmark
 * node cannot trigger fleet-wide eviction. The values in
 * force are the following.
 */

tuning table, faweg-bajep:
WEIGHTS = {
    "belius": 690,
    "eliox": 458,
    "norax": 616,
    "praion": 132,
    "zorvan": 911,
}

## Step 2: Turn down the noise from Chirpline

Quick recap for the sync: Chirpline is still logging every heartbeat at INFO, which is why our ingest bill doubled last month. This step enables sampling so we keep 1-in-50 routine lines but always pass errors and anything tagged `billing`. Roll it out to the canary pool first, watch the dashboards for an hour, then fleet-wide. Once you're on a canary host, drop the following settings into the logging config.

config for bafof-tajef:
[silion]
port = 5000
team = silmir
host = silion.crelvonet.internal
region = lower-3
access_code = ac_1f1b57
timeout_ms = 2000

### Markdown Rendering Pipeline — Notes

We walked through the Quillbarrow rendering pipeline end to end. The sanitizer now runs before the extension pass, which fixed the nested-table escaping bug, but we agreed to add regression fixtures covering footnotes and raw HTML blocks. Caching of rendered fragments stays disabled until invalidation is proven correct under concurrent edits. Rollout to the Delmere docs site is gated on one more review pass. Ownership for the pipeline is confirmed as follows.

approver of yawig-yajef = Briius Jorix